.flash-icon {
  animation: flash 3s infinite;
}

/* money用：黄色点滅 */
.gold {
  color: gold;
  animation-name: flash-money;
}

@keyframes flash-money {
  0%, 100% { color: gold; text-shadow: 0 0 5px orange; }
  50%      { color: gray; text-shadow: none; }
}

/* message用：青色点滅 */
.blue {
  color: dodgerblue;
  animation-name: flash-message;
}

@keyframes flash-message {
  0%, 100% { color: dodgerblue; text-shadow: 0 0 5px skyblue; }
  50%      { color: gray; text-shadow: none; }
}


  .navbar-brand:hover {
    background-color: #f0f0f0;  /* 背景を薄グレーに */
    color: #0d6efd !important;  /* Bootstrapのprimary色に */
    border-radius: 5px;
    padding: 5px 10px;
    transition: background-color 0.3s;
  }
